Abstract

For the research of becoming and development of professional self-esteem of future doctors we distinguished two kinds of self-esteem, which differ in the level of universality and regulation potential. Differential-personality self-esteem is actualized concerning separate activities or social roles and is expressed mostly in cognitions; emotional- estimative component is secondary. Integral-personality self-esteem reflects integral emotional- estimative attitude of personality to itself or to the separate stages of its development; cognitive component is reduced. Professional self-esteem is a result of comparison by a person of own professional qualities with social or personality standards. Interaction of cognitive and emotional-estimative components of self-esteem actualizes its regulative functions, directed on the professional and personality self-development. Distinguishing of cognitive-operational (actions, operations, skills) and referent-value (referent persons and features of personality) components of abilities gave an opportunity to create a model of professional self-esteem genesis. It is characterized by the increasing of value constructs number depending of the term of study, displacement of valuating criteria from external (demands of pedagogues, social values) to internal (personal standards of activity – activity values and professionally significant personal qualities – moral values). With the help of professional self-consciousness’ psychosemantic modeling it is ascertained, that the development of future doctors’ self-esteem in the process of professionalization is regulated by subjective values – interrelated highly significant activity and moral evaluative constructs. Comparison of differential-personality and integral-personality indicators gave an opportunity to develop the typology of future doctors’ professional self-esteem and to point the ways for the increasing of its regulative potential in the process of professionalization.
